Scarborough Busway Opens September | Toronto News
Toronto’s Scarborough Busway is set to launch this September—six months ahead of schedule—offering a vital transit lifeline as the old RT Line 3 remains shut down after a derailment. Running four kilometers from Kennedy Station to Ellesmere, it’ll serve key stops like Tara and Lawrence East, bridging the gap until the long-awaited subway extension arrives in 2030. Mayor Chow calls it a win-win for riders and traffic flow, while TTC tests begin next month. A smart, timely upgrade that gets commuters moving faster before the big subway project finishes.
